Rent prices jumped 3.1% in 2017. Will prices continue to increase? As a result of housing prices bottoming out in 2012, rent prices have increased drastically. According to Trulia’s rental analysis, the price of rent continues to increase in major metropolitan areas such as Washington, Sacramento, Milwaukee, and Los Angeles and show no sign of slowing down. Since the end of 2012, the total rent has increased by 19.6% overall. With rent prices steadily rising, it may be time for you to consider purchasing your own home! How to choose the perfect neighborhood: When you start shopping for a new home, there are quite a few factors that you should consider. A monthly budget is going to be the first thing on your mind, but first, where are you going to place that new home of yours? Do you remember the old phrase Location, Location, Location? It does matter! What other things should you consider when location shopping? 1. Property Taxes - Make sure to check your particular county for this info...rmation as is could play a big part in your overall cost of living 2. Safety and Crime - No matter how big or small of a family you have, each person’s safety is top priority! You can check sites like http://qoo.ly/kty6b or the Crime Reports 3. Topography and Geography - -Depending on the area that you choose, could change the type of insurance you need to get, where you may place your home, etc. 4. Property Value - The value of your property is always going to be important. Whether the area is projected to grow, what other homes in the area hold for similar to yours, etc. Your agent should provide this information to you 5. School Zones - If you have children or plan to have them soon, knowing which school your child will be attending and how far it is from your home, is an important aspect.
